Output 30bb8d56ae649256f18d243c30d1109d3253283e176e8f73122c484c9df29a74:3

value
217415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5689ce6829f442b766081f4f5413f62dbc20e9a3 OP_EQUAL
address
39ab7zKkheKUoww8jiouh4KJKRUvPzDbHd
transaction
30bb8d56ae649256f18d243c30d1109d3253283e176e8f73122c484c9df29a74
spent
true